Study with birds Flemish painter, 18th century
Flemish painter, 18th century
Technique: oil on board
The tondo, with its highly decorative character, is probably a study for a larger composition, perhaps for a portion of a wall fresco or a ceiling frieze: some birds are painted precisely for the foreshortened view from below. There are drops of pictorial material. Framed
